Вопросы по теме 'threadpool'

Исключения для потоков threadpool
Связанный: Как перехватывать исключения из ThreadPool.QueueUserWorkItem? Исключения в потоках .Net ThreadPool Если метод вызывает исключение, вызываемое методом ThreadPool.QueueUserWorkItem, где будет выброшено исключение? или его...
4083 просмотров
schedule 12.11.2023

Разумное количество потоков для пула потоков, выполняющих запросы веб-службы
При создании объекта Executor FixedThreadPool в Java вам необходимо передать аргумент, описывающий количество потоков, которые Executor может выполнять одновременно. Я создаю класс обслуживания, который отвечает за обработку больших коллекций...
9619 просмотров
schedule 06.12.2023

Влияет ли на него изменение культуры потока пула потоков, когда он возвращается обратно в пул?
Если я установлю CurrentCulture потока пула потоков, что произойдет, когда поток завершит выполнение и вернется обратно в пул потоков? Вернет ли он CurrentCulture значение по умолчанию (что бы это ни значило) или он сохранит культуру, которую я...
2602 просмотров

C # более низкий приоритет потока в пуле потоков
У меня есть несколько задач с низкой нагрузкой, которые нужно выполнить, когда доступно некоторое время процессора. Я не хочу, чтобы эта задача выполнялась, если выполняется другая задача импорта. Т.е. если приходит задача с нормальным / высоким...
6477 просмотров
schedule 17.02.2024

.Net Как создать собственный пул потоков, общий для всех доменов приложений процесса?
Я сделал собственный ThreadPool, оптимизированный для моих конкретных нужд. Однако, когда в процессе используется несколько доменов приложений, CLR ThreadPool может использоваться всеми доменами приложений, и я хотел бы иметь возможность...
1167 просмотров
schedule 26.04.2023

многопоточный вопрос для большого пакетного процесса
У нас есть пакетный процесс, состоящий примерно из 5 вычислений, которые выполняются для каждой строки данных (всего 20 миллионов строк). Наш рабочий сервер будет иметь около 24 процессоров с приличными процессорами. Для нас критична...
3204 просмотров
schedule 20.02.2023

Синхронизация объектов с использованием ThreadPool
У меня есть несколько объектов процессора, которые я использую с ThreadPool, чтобы использовать их в параллельном процессе. Какой процессор я собираюсь использовать, в основном зависит от входящих данных, и может быть более 2000 различных типов;...
456 просмотров

Обеспечение безопасности потоков
Я нахожусь в процессе написания приложения C# Windows Form, которое обрабатывает рыночные котировки с помощью алгоритма (стратегии) ​​для создания заказов брокерской фирме. Все это, кажется, тестировалось довольно хорошо, пока я не попытался создать...
387 просмотров
schedule 25.05.2022

Проблема CAsyncSocket и ThreadPool
У меня есть серверное приложение с такой структурой: Есть один объект, назовем его Сервер, который в бесконечном цикле слушает и принимает соединения. У меня есть класс-потомок от CAsyncSocket, который переопределяет событие OnReceive, назовем его...
407 просмотров
schedule 23.06.2022

Как управлять пулом потоков Java SwingWorker по умолчанию?
У меня есть приложение, которое использует 2 длительные задачи SwingWorker, и я только что столкнулся с парой компьютеров Windows с обновленными JVM, которые запускают только одну из них. Ошибок не указано, поэтому я должен предположить, что пул...
6214 просмотров
schedule 18.09.2023

Я захожу в тупик? Почему?
У меня есть приложение Silverlight 3, которому необходимо вызвать службу WCF. Служба WCF, в свою очередь, вызывает веб-службу ASMX. После завершения вызова службы WCF пользовательский интерфейс silverlight необходимо обновить. WCF вызывается в...
467 просмотров

Почему ScheduledThreadPoolExecutor принимает только фиксированное количество потоков?
Я могу представить себе, что некоторые задачи должны выполняться очень долго, и ScheduledThreadPoolExecutor будет создавать дополнительные потоки для других задач, которые необходимо выполнить, пока не будет достигнуто максимальное количество...
8880 просмотров
schedule 11.10.2022

Сигнализация веб-страницы, когда поток ThreadPool завершен
С веб-страницы я запускаю трудоемкую работу и обновляю ее статус в пользовательском интерфейсе с помощью веб-метода. Работа выполняется в потоке: ThreadPool.QueueUserWorkItem(new WaitCallback(DoJob), parameters); Задание устанавливает...
155 просмотров
schedule 12.12.2022

Обработка исключений в ThreadPools
У меня есть ScheduledThreadPoolExecutor, который, кажется, ест исключения. Я хочу, чтобы моя служба-исполнитель уведомляла меня, если отправленный Runnable выдает исключение. Например, я хотел бы, чтобы приведенный ниже код по крайней мере...
24747 просмотров
schedule 07.11.2023

Создает ли ThreadPoolExecutor новый поток, если текущий поток спит?
Этот вопрос является продолжением этого . По сути, я объявляю ThreadPoolExecutor всего одним потоком. Я переопределяю метод beforeExecute() , чтобы поставить сон, чтобы каждая из моих задач выполнялась с некоторой задержкой между собой. Это в...
1846 просмотров

Как создать LIFO-исполнитель?
Я хотел бы создать пул потоков, который будет выполнять самую последнюю отправленную задачу. Любые советы о том, как это сделать? Спасибо
6265 просмотров
schedule 04.06.2023

связь через последовательный порт накапливает большое количество запущенных потоков
У нас есть следующий код C# для связи через последовательный порт: ProcCntrlSSPort = new SerialPort(portNumber, 115200, Parity.None, 8, StopBits.One); ProcCntrlSSPort.Handshake = Handshake.None;...
2442 просмотров
schedule 24.02.2022

Shutdown Daemon Thread, который читает в очереди
У меня есть поток, который зацикливает очередь, читает задачи и делегирует их CachedThreadPool. Эта очередь постоянно заполняется задачами, отправленными клиентом. Я хочу, чтобы поток чтения завершался, если также завершаются клиентские программы....
990 просмотров
schedule 27.06.2022

Как настроить ASP.NET MVC для обработки загруженных данных независимо от запроса?
Я только начинаю изучать ASP.NET MVC. Веб-сайт, над которым я работаю, требует от пользователя загрузки файлов XML, которые загружаются в базу данных SQL через NHibernate. Теперь это нормально работает с небольшим файлом XML, но как только я...
492 просмотров

Идентифицировать объекты в boost :: shared_ptr ‹boost :: thread›
Я создаю приложение на основе примера на сайте boost. Вот соответствующие определения, о которых следует знать: typedef boost::shared_ptr< connection > connection_ptr; std::set< connection_ptr> connections_; std::vector<...
1359 просмотров